WellSpring - Wichita Health Professions Associate’s Program

Of the 16 health professions students who graduated with a associate's degree in 2020-2021 from WellSpring - Wichita, about 6% were men and 94% were women.

undefined

The majority of the students with this major are white. About 88% of 2021 graduates were in this category.
